Răspuns :
Răspuns:
Restricţii şi precizări
☐ 1 ≤ n ≤ 1000
☐ cele n numere citite sunt mai mici decât
2,000,000,000
■ dacă exista mai multe numere cu aceeași suma minima/maxima se va afișa primul găsit
Exemplu
Intrare
5 145 225 198 326 874
leşire
225
874
Explicaţie
145 -> 1+4+5=10
225 -> 2+2+5=9 (minimul)
198 -> 1+9+8=18
326 -> 3+2+6=11
874 -> 8+7+4=19 (maximul)
#include <bits/stdc++.h>
using namespace std;
int main()
[
int n.tmp.s=0;
int
max=0.min-100, smin-100, smax=0;
int a;
cin>>n;
for (int i=1; i <=
n; ++i)
{
cin >> tmp:
a= tmp:
while (tmp)
{
s+ tmp;
tmp/ 10:
}
if (s>smax)
smin = s ,min = a:
smax S if (s<smin)
smin = s ,min = a:
s=0;
}
cout << min<<endl<< r
return 0;
}
Explicație:
Sper că e bine
Vă mulțumim că ați ales să vizitați site-ul nostru dedicat Informatică. Sperăm că informațiile disponibile v-au fost utile. Dacă aveți întrebări sau aveți nevoie de asistență suplimentară, vă rugăm să ne contactați. Revenirea dumneavoastră ne va bucura, iar pentru acces rapid, nu uitați să ne salvați la favorite!